Well, you might ask, what the heck does it do exactly? ???

The script uses some fancy coding to create a "modified" CH-47D with the ability to act as a gunship similar to the AC-130 Spooky/Spectre gunship.  The forementioned helo will orbit a strike area and rain death upon the enemy with three independently targeted and fired weapons.  The ACH-47D gunship sports a 7.62mm minigun, a 40mm AGL, and a 90mm cannon. Like the AC-130, the weapons fire from the left side of the gunship as the pilot makes pylon turn around the target area.

BTW this is a fictitious unit, but a logical adaptation of current technology and entirely possible.  In my "OFP universe", the Army has decided that it needs a "Spooky" asset of it's own (as the AC-130 is an Air force asset), and has retrofitted the Chinook with a scaled weapons load.

The script was inspired by real world gun camera footage of an AC-130 conducting an attack on some Afghani terrorist scum.

Actually, I did download and try out a C-130 (aside from the weapons mounted on the port side they are the same basic airframe).  The problem was that due to the wide turning radius, the C-130 was too far away for my current system's (a 3 year old Alienware 1 gig AMD) graphic setting to draw in the model.  The tracers would seem to come from nowhere.  When my new Alienware gets here in a week or so I'm sure that I will be able to pretty much max the settings, but not everyone out there has that luxury.

If you do have a high end system it would be woth checking out.  All you really need to do is delete the CH-47D in the editor and replace it with a C-130 named "Spooky".  I haven't really messed with having fixed wing aircraft take off and land with a script, but I think you might need to locate it at a functioning Airport as well or it will just try to drive the whole way cross country (had some A-10s doo that once)...
